Abstract

This dataset reports 74 profiles of <53um and >53um concentrations of particulate organic carbon (POC), particulate inorganic carbon (PIC), and biogenic silica (bSi) collected and analyzed by James K.B. Bishop from 17 cruises using ship-powered (Multiple Unit) Large Volume In-situ Filtration (LVFS, later MULVFS) between 1973 and 2005. The dataset was compiled by Phoebe Lam.

This dataset compiles size fractionated (less than 53 micrometers (<53um) and greater than 53 micrometers (>53um)) particulate organic carbon (POC), particulate inorganic carbon (PIC), and biogenic silica (bSi concentrations collected by the Large Volume in-situ Filtration System (LVFS, Bishop and Edmond, 1976) and the Multiple Unit Large Volume in-situ Filtration System (MULVFS, Bishop, et al., 1985) between 1973 and 2005. A description of the compilation is given in Lam, et al. (2011), and the >53um POC, bSi, and PIC and 1-53um POC data were published in the supplemental information of that paper. This data submission adds 1-53um PIC and 0.4um-53um bSi to those data, as well as includes a few more coastal stations that were not reported in Lam, et al. (2011).
